Transaction ef141f0062138ec9ae0f26c1dc60b3bf4af338c42a1ad9576049e5bd12c9c483
1 Input
1 Output
-
ef141f0062138ec9ae0f26c1dc60b3bf4af338c42a1ad9576049e5bd12c9c483:0
- value
- 99288
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ba9b76486ef5be7bcf004bb3c84048d36f06155
- address
- bc1q8w5mweyxaad7008sqjanepqy35m0qc24plapdc